## Sensor drift: what to do at 3am

If the GrowLoop controller starts reporting humidity swings that don't match the backup probes in the Fernwick greenhouse, it's almost always sensor drift, not an actual climate event. Don't panic and don't touch the vents manually. First, restart the calibration daemon and give it ten minutes to re-baseline. If readings still disagree by more than 5%, flip the controller into safe mode. The safe-mode thresholds it will use are these.

config for yahap-bajof:
[istix]
host = istix.qorvelsys.internal
user = istix_svc
database = istix_prod

// Heads up, plugin folks: this is the order-cutoff constant for
// CrumbCart's daily bake scheduler. Orders placed after this hour
// (local bakery time, not UTC — we learned that the hard way)
// roll over to the next bake day. Don't override it in your plugin;
// the ovens genuinely cannot fit more trays, and support gets the
// angry messages, not you. If you think your use case needs an
// exception, open a discussion thread first. This value was last
// validated against the build noted below.

trace token, fafof-tajef: htk9_849b0fd88

Internal Memo — Expansion into the Ostermark Region

To all branch managers: the board has approved entry into the Ostermark region beginning next fiscal year. A regional office will open in Valdenbury, with two satellite branches to follow. Recruitment and premises work start this quarter; logistics routing will be confirmed separately. Keep this within management until the public announcement. The confidential planning note appears directly below.

management briefing: Jorixax Holdings is in early talks to buy Casixax Holdings for about $420.3 million. The Fenmir launch date is October 27, and nothing goes to the press before then. Legal wants the Keloxek Foods term sheet redrafted before April 16.

## Releases

The DateShape library localizes date formats for all Lornview products. Releases cut from main every two weeks after the locale regression suite passes. New team members: bump the version in the manifest, run the packager, and upload the artifact through the release CLI. Every package must be signed before publishing; the CLI will prompt for the signing key shown below.

deploy key for kajof-fajop: bky6_gDHw9Q